WelcomeThis website is designed in programmed instruction style. This method of instruction is sometimes called "self-instruction", and it means exactly that: YOU TEACH YOURSELF, with a minimum of time and effort on your part. Though it includes many questions, these are NOT TEST QUESTIONS. The questions are designed to assist learning by using your active participation. The text of the course is made up of a series of sentences or short paragraphs, called frames, each of which not only presents some information to you, but also requires you to respond in some way. The questions are in all cases directly related to the information you have just read in the frame or in the previous few frames. These questions are designed to ensure that you understand what you have read. The correct answer is always provided at the end of the frame. If you want to go back over anything you don't understand, then by all means do so. After you have completed the frames in a section, go on to the Self-Test. This will help you review the highlights of the section and measure how much you have learned.
